Classic Indoor Scavenger Hunts

Indoor scavenger hunts are ideal for days when you want to keep the fun contained within the home. Here are some creative ideas:

Color Hunt

  • Objective: Find objects of a specific color around the house.
  • Instructions: Give children a list of colors and ask them to find items that match each color. For example, find something red, blue, green, etc.
  • Learning Outcome: This hunt helps children recognize and differentiate between colors while enhancing their observational skills.

Alphabet Hunt

  • Objective: Find items that start with each letter of the alphabet.
  • Instructions: Create a list with the alphabet and ask children to find items starting with each letter. For example, A for apple, B for book, and so on.
  • Learning Outcome: This hunt promotes letter recognition and phonics skills, crucial for early reading development.

Outdoor Adventure Scavenger Hunts

Outdoor scavenger hunts combine physical activity with learning, making them perfect for energetic 7-year-olds. Here are some engaging ideas:

Nature Scavenger Hunt

  • Objective: Find natural items such as leaves, rocks, flowers, and insects.
  • Instructions: Provide a list of nature items and encourage children to find them in a park or backyard.
  • Learning Outcome: This hunt teaches children about nature and the environment, enhancing their observational skills and knowledge of the natural world.

Shape Hunt

  • Objective: Find items of different shapes.
  • Instructions: Give children a list of shapes (circle, square, triangle, etc.) and ask them to find objects that match these shapes outdoors.
  • Learning Outcome: This activity helps children recognize geometric shapes and apply this knowledge in real-world settings, supporting early math skills.

Themed Scavenger Hunts

Themed scavenger hunts add an extra layer of excitement by incorporating popular characters or stories. Here are some fun themes:

Pirate Treasure Hunt

  • Objective: Find hidden "treasures" using a map and clues.
  • Instructions: Create a simple treasure map with clues leading to various locations where small treasures are hidden.
  • Learning Outcome: This hunt encourages problem-solving, map reading, and teamwork. It’s a great way to combine imaginative play with practical skills.

Superhero Adventure

  • Objective: Complete tasks to "save the day" like a superhero.
  • Instructions: Design tasks that resemble superhero missions, such as finding items that represent superpowers (e.g., a red cape for strength).
  • Learning Outcome: This activity promotes creativity, role-playing, and teamwork, allowing children to engage in imaginative play while learning about heroism and cooperation.

Educational Scavenger Hunts

Scavenger hunts can be a great way to reinforce what children are learning in school. Here are some educational ideas:

Math Hunt

  • Objective: Find items that correspond to different numbers or solve simple math problems.
  • Instructions: Ask children to find a specific number of items or solve math problems that lead them to the next clue.
  • Learning Outcome: This hunt enhances math skills, such as counting, addition, and subtraction, making math fun and interactive.

Science Hunt

  • Objective: Discover items related to basic science concepts.
  • Instructions: Create a list of science-related items or phenomena (e.g., something that sinks, something that floats, a magnet).
  • Learning Outcome: This hunt helps children explore scientific principles and develop a curiosity about the world around them, laying the foundation for future scientific learning.

Holiday and Seasonal Scavenger Hunts

Seasonal and holiday-themed scavenger hunts are perfect for adding a festive touch to the activity. Here are some ideas:

Halloween Hunt

  • Objective: Find spooky items or complete Halloween-themed tasks.
  • Instructions: Provide a list of Halloween items (e.g., a black cat decoration, a pumpkin, spider webs) and hide them around the house or yard.
  • Learning Outcome: This hunt adds a fun twist to the holiday while encouraging creativity and observation. Children can also learn about Halloween traditions and symbols.

Easter Egg Hunt

  • Objective: Find hidden Easter eggs with clues or small prizes inside.
  • Instructions: Hide Easter eggs around the yard or house and give children clues to find them.
  • Learning Outcome: This classic hunt promotes problem-solving and adds excitement to the holiday. It encourages children to think critically and follow clues.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the best way to set up a scavenger hunt for 7-year-olds?

The best way to set up a scavenger hunt for 7-year-olds is to ensure the clues and tasks are age-appropriate, balancing challenge and fun. Use themes or subjects that interest them and provide clear instructions.

How can scavenger hunts benefit my child’s development?

Scavenger hunts can benefit children’s development by enhancing skills such as problem-solving, observation, critical thinking, teamwork, and physical activity. They also promote learning in a fun and interactive way.

Are scavenger hunts suitable for both indoor and outdoor settings?

Yes, scavenger hunts can be designed for both indoor and outdoor settings. Indoor hunts are great for rainy days, while outdoor hunts offer the added benefit of physical activity and exploration of nature.

What are some creative themes for scavenger hunts?

Creative themes for scavenger hunts include Pirate Treasure Hunts, Superhero Adventures, Nature Hunts, Holiday-themed Hunts (like Halloween or Easter), and Educational Hunts (focusing on subjects like math or science).

How can I make a scavenger hunt educational?

You can make a scavenger hunt educational by incorporating learning objectives related to subjects such as math, science, or literacy. For example, include tasks that involve counting, identifying shapes, or finding items that start with specific letters.
